I am a State Registered Paramedic, with some 19 years experience as an Offshore Medic in the offshore Oil, Gas & Renewable Energy industries, both on floating and fixed installations in the UK sector of the North Sea, ROV construction and support and, most recently, offshore wind farm construction vessels off the UK coast.
During this time, I have undertaken the equipping and setting-up of 2 F.P.S.O. installation's medical facilities, including the preparation of equipment schedules and medical stocks in line with both SI1019 and M1319, as well as preparation and delivery of medical party personnel training and multiple casualty contingency planning. In addition I have previously set up and operated medical treatment centres in remote locations whilst serving in H.M. forces.
I have medical and administrative skills which have been developed and expanded to cater for the requirements of the ever changing offshore industry and pressures imposed on personnel to undertake varied and diverse tasks.
I am computer literate, with experience of Microsoft operating systems and Office products including development of applications to carry out various administrative tasks.
I have been involved with the provision and presentation of Health Promotions materials towards Scottish Health At Work awards including leaflet / poster campaigns and presentations to personnel at crew meetings. Also operation of noise dosimetry equipment, to record individual work exposure for personnel identified as being at risk under installation N.E.M.S. programmes.
I am capable of working both as an individual, and as part of a team, as dictated by the task, or tasks, at hand, to deadlines and producing work to a high standard for reports and presentations.
I have good communications skills and am experienced in dealing with personnel from all areas of the workforce and management structure both offshore and onshore.
